Understanding the FA Cup Qualification Rounds
The Football Association Challenge Cup, commonly known as the FA Cup, is one of the oldest and most prestigious football competitions in the world. The qualification rounds serve as the gateway to this historic tournament, providing teams from lower leagues the opportunity to compete against top-tier clubs. This section will delve into the intricacies of the FA Cup qualification rounds in England, highlighting the structure, significance, and excitement they bring to the football calendar.

The Significance of FA Cup Qualification Rounds
For many lower-league clubs, competing in the FA Cup qualification rounds is more than just an opportunity to play football; it’s a chance to make history and achieve something extraordinary. Here’s why these rounds are so significant:
- Financial Rewards: Advancing through each round brings substantial financial benefits. Winning teams receive prize money that can significantly impact a club’s budget, especially for those operating on tight financial constraints.
- Exposure and Prestige: Competing against higher-league teams offers lower-league clubs national exposure and prestige. A strong performance can elevate a club’s profile and attract new fans and sponsors.
- Competitive Edge: The intensity and quality of matches increase as teams progress through the rounds. For lower-league players, this is an invaluable experience against top-tier talent, providing both challenge and opportunity for personal growth.
The dream of facing a Premier League giant is a powerful motivator for players and fans alike, making every match in these rounds a potential David vs. Goliath encounter.
